
Rabat: Thousands of people marched in Moroccan cities on Sunday demanding King Mohammed VI give up some of his powers.
In Moroccan capital Rabat, police allowed protesters, raising slogans like "The people reject a constitution made for slaves", to approach parliament, the BBC reported.
A separate protest is under way in the country's biggest city, Casablanca, and another was planned in Marrakesh, the report said.
Sunday's rallies in Morocco have been organised by groups including one calling itself the "February 20 Movement for Change"....
